S2 E42 | Ride with Alissa Hale: From Alabama to Florida, Alissa Hale’s Country Music Journey

Meet Alissa Hale, a rising country star who’s redefining what it means to be a modern artist. Born and raised in Alabama with a 12-year background in gymnastics and ballet, Alissa’s path to music came through an unexpected intersection of talent, determination, and a mother who believed in her enough to talk her up to a music producer.

During this candid conversation, Alissa gives listeners an exclusive world premiere of her upcoming single “Ride” – a bold, wild anthem for Southern girls who aren’t afraid to embrace their freedom and make no apologies for it. The track, releasing June 20th, perfectly captures her authentic country roots while bringing a fresh energy to the genre.

What makes Alissa truly unique is her innovative approach to building her brand. She’s created “Dirty Blonde,” a groundbreaking zombie video game that integrates her music into gameplay – something never before seen in country music. Players blast “deadheads” while experiencing her songs in an immersive environment, creating an entirely new way for fans to connect with her work. This creativity extends to her entrepreneurial ventures, including a hot sauce line featuring her signature blend and an upcoming ghost pepper version aptly named “Hot as Hell.”

S2 E41 | Hard Money, Hard Lessons with Caleb Delgado

What happens when life knocks you down not once, but twice—and you find the strength to build something even better than before?

Caleb’s journey from Queens-born soccer player to mortgage mogul to nearly bankrupt and back again is a masterclass in resilience and entrepreneurial spirit. Growing up in Long Island with immigrant parents, he learned early lessons contrasting wealth and struggle that would prove invaluable later in life.

His soccer skills earned him a D1 college spot playing center midfield, but family financial troubles forced him to leave school and enter the mortgage industry at just 20. The timing couldn’t have been more dramatic—the early 2000s “Boiler Room” era of mortgage lending. Within months, Caleb was making hundreds of thousands, driving luxury cars, dropping $10,000 on dinner tabs, and living what seemed like the dream. Until 2008 hit.

S2 E40 | Black Clover The Fight Within: Balancing Trucking and MMA Dreams

In the realm of combat sports, few stories embody raw determination quite like that of Forrest “The Black Clover.” From the humble beginnings of Dade City, Florida, where growing up with seven brothers meant daily wrestling matches were simply part of life, Forrest has carved a unique path to becoming a 6-1 professional MMA fighter while maintaining a full-time career as a truck driver.

This conversation peels back the layers of what makes a fighter persist despite overwhelming odds. Forrest reveals how he manages the seemingly impossible—driving trucks across state lines, sometimes to Texas and back, while maintaining the discipline to train, cut weight, and dominate in the cage. “If you want it bad enough, you’re going to find a way to do it,” he shares, describing how he performs pull-ups in his truck and jumps rope in the back of trailers just to stay conditioned while working.

What truly separates this fighter is his authentic approach to both victory and defeat. After amassing an impressive 8-0 amateur record, Forrest transitioned to pro fighting with refreshing honesty about his motivations: “What made me stop at eight was I wanted to get paid.” His lone professional loss became not a setback but a catalyst, especially after seeing the look on his young son’s face following the fight: “No more losing in front of you, this ain’t happening,” he vowed. True to his word, his comeback fight ended with a devastating first-round TKO.

S2 E39 | The Art of Melodizing: Young Hub's Musical Journey

Dive into the exhilarating fusion of sports, music, and lively debates in the latest episode of Happy Hour Holidaze, where hosts Sean and Manny Febre, alongside guest host Max Paul, welcome Tampa’s very own rising star, Young Hub. Known for his distinctive “melodizing” style—a creative blend of rap and singing reminiscent of Drake’s early sound—Young Hub drops in to share insights from his latest project, Melodizing 3. But this episode isn’t just about music; it’s a vibrant exploration of the intersections between athletics, personal journeys, and cultural identity.

Unpacking “Melodizing 3”

The conversation begins with Young Hub introducing his newest mixtape, Melodizing 3, a continuation of a trilogy that uniquely combines melodic singing and rhythmic rapping. Hub describes his musical approach as instinctive, something he coined as “melodizing.” He expresses genuine humility, openly stating he doesn’t like to judge his own music, leaving that to listeners and fans. With “Soul Cry” as the standout single, Hub confidently believes this release will significantly elevate his profile.

Listeners get a behind-the-scenes look at Young Hub’s creative process, offering a glimpse into his mindset when developing music that resonates deeply with personal authenticity and emotional vulnerability. His distinct Tampa flavor is palpable, clearly reflecting local influences and his own lived experiences.

Max Paul’s Arena Football Tales

The podcast takes an intriguing turn when guest host Max Paul shares his personal journey playing professional arena football. His vivid storytelling brings to life the intense, often overlooked world of arena sports—complete with anecdotes of trash-talking fans mid-play, dramatic contract negotiations, and the physical toll of slamming into arena walls.

Max’s authentic narrative sheds light on the harsh realities and exciting thrills of professional athletics beyond mainstream sports leagues. His experiences captivate listeners and underscore the sacrifices athletes often make for their passion, including the ultimate decision to retire and prioritize family over continued play.
